Cheesecake Factory’s (CAKE) Overweight Rating Reaffirmed at Stephens

by · The Markets Daily

Cheesecake Factory (NASDAQ:CAKEGet Free Report)‘s stock had its “overweight” rating reiterated by investment analysts at Stephens in a research note issued to investors on Tuesday, Benzinga reports. They currently have a $50.00 price target on the restaurant operator’s stock. Stephens’ price target points to a potential upside of 17.79% from the stock’s previous close.

Cheesecake Factory Price Performance

NASDAQ:CAKE opened at $42.45 on Tues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.26, a current ratio of 0.43 and a quick ratio of 0.32. The firm has a market cap of $2.16 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 19.47,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.13 and a beta of 1.49.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$39.12 and a 200-day moving average price of $37.91. Cheesecake Factory has a 1-year low of $29.27 and a 1-year high of $43.41.

Cheesecake Factory (NASDAQ:CAKEG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, July 31st. The restaurant operator reported $1.09 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.00 by $0.09. The firm had revenue of $904.04 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$909.19 million. Cheesecake Factory had a net margin of 3.32% and a return on equity of 43.62%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 4.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.88 EPS. Equities research analysts forecast that Cheesecake Factory will post 3.21 EPS for the current year.

About Cheesecake Factory

The Cheesecake Factory Incorporated operates and licenses restaurants in the United States and Canada. The company operates bakeries that produce cheesecakes and other baked products for its restaurants, international licensees, third-party bakery customers, external foodservice operators, retailers, and distributors.
